♚News – Manus, a new “agentic” AI platform that launched in preview last week, is already generating significant buzz. Chinese media quickly labeled it a breakthrough—QQ News called it “the pride of domestic products.”

Industry experts were equally impressed. Hugging Face’s head of product called Manus “the most impressive AI tool I’ve ever tried,” while AI policy researcher Dean Ball described it as the “most sophisticated computer using AI.”

The excitement has translated into rapid adoption. Manus’ official Discord server grew to over 138,000 members in just a few days, and invite codes are reportedly selling for thousands of dollars on Chinese resale app Xianyu.

đŸ€”What’s the catch? Manus isn’t entirely built from scratch. Reports suggest it combines fine-tuned versions of existing AI models, including Anthropic’s Claude and Alibaba’s Qwen, to perform tasks like drafting research reports and analyzing financial filings.

Despite this, The Butterfly Effect—the company behind Manus—has made ambitious claims, suggesting it can do everything from buying real estate to developing video games. In a viral video on X, research lead Yichao “Peak” Ji implied that Manus outperforms OpenAI’s deep research. But some early users aren’t convinced. Alexander Doria, co-founder of AI startup Pleias, reported running into errors and infinite loops. Others have pointed out factual mistakes, missing citations, and inconsistent results.

đŸ€č‍♂In conclusion – Manus is still in its early stages, and its developers say they’re working to scale its capabilities and address reported issues. But for now, the excitement around the platform may be running ahead of what it can actually deliver.

☕News - Foxconn, the world’s largest electronics contract manufacturer and a key Apple supplier, has introduced its first large language model (LLM) trained on traditional Chinese characters. The move marks a major step in the company’s efforts to integrate AI into manufacturing.  

đŸ‘šâ€đŸ’»Here's the lowdown - Called FoxBrain, the model was developed in just four weeks using a “more efficient and lower-cost” training method, according to Foxconn. The company says this is a milestone for Taiwan’s AI industry.  

FoxBrain was trained using 120 Nvidia H100 GPUs and is designed to excel in math and logical reasoning. Initially built for internal use, Foxconn plans to open-source it in the future to encourage collaboration and expand AI applications in manufacturing.  

The model is based on Meta’s Llama 3.1 architecture and has 70 billion parameters. Foxconn claims it outperforms Llama-3-Taiwan-70B—another open-source model trained on traditional Chinese and English—on most categories of TMMLU+, a key benchmark for traditional Chinese language understanding.
